Deadline approaches for Hillsborough magnets

ntp_modelun010812a_205766c.jpgThe clock is ticking if you want to enroll your child in a magnet, choice or career education program in Hillsborough County.

The enrollment period for high schools and middle schools ends Wednesday, Jan. 11. The application period for elementary school closes Wednesday, Feb. 29.

There is no need to apply to remain at a magnet or choice program; or attend your neighborhood school.

Enroll online if your child already attends school in Hillsborough County or download the appropriate application if you are from out of the county, and mail it to the address on the application. Questions? Call (813) 272-4692.
